Governor threatens to expose Buhari, says President is on life support machine

Fayose also said that the First Lady, Aisha Buhari was not allowed to see Buhari during her last visit to London.

According to Punch, Fayose also alleged that the President has been on a life support machine since June 6, 2017.

The Ekiti state Governor also called on Buhari’s media team to tell Nigerians the truth, adding that the audio broadcast was a fake.

Fayose, who told newsmen that the President is suffering from a voice impairment, said the Sallah broadcast was used to deceive Nigerians.

He also said that the First Lady, Aisha Buhari was not allowed to see Buhari during her last visit to London.

The Governor said “Today, it makes 53 days since our president left Nigeria to attend to his health challenges abroad. No official information as to his whereabouts and his state of health.

“Like every other Nigerians, I do not wish the president dead, I have therefore maintained dignified silence since we were told that the president embarked on his second medical trip abroad this year.

“However, the recorded audio message which was released by the Presidency as the president’s Ramadan message to Nigerians necessitated my setting the records straight today.

“The audio message does not represent the truth as our President does not only have voice impairment, he has been on life-support since June 6, 2017, at a West-End, London Hospital.”

“Only three Nigerians who are of the president’s cabal are allowed access to the president. I will keep their identities for now.

“Anyone with contrary claim should produce the president to Nigerians within the next 48 hours. I want to say emphatically that Acting President Yemi Osinbajo has not spoken to the president in the last one month. I expect him to prove me wrong,” he added.

Governor Ayo Fayose recently declared his intention to run for President in 2019.
